Unlocking Melodies
by Greyson Vale
He broke Jimmy’s heart once. Now, he might be the only one who can save it.
Jimmy doesn’t remember much—just fragments of a life he used to live. After waking up in Oakwood Grove with a pounding headache and a pile of questions, he’s determined to reclaim himself, even if his past refuses to cooperate. What he does know is that trust doesn’t come easy anymore, especially when the scars of betrayal run deep.
Ethan Cole, now a tech billionaire, never meant to leave Jimmy. Back in college, Ethan thought he had no choice—protecting Jimmy meant disappearing, even if it shattered them both. But when Ethan learns the devastating truth of what happened after he left, he can’t stay away.
Their reunion is anything but simple. Jimmy’s father’s shady dealings have put Jimmy in danger, leaving Ethan scrambling to untangle the web of debts and threats. And with Jimmy’s memory still patchy at best, how can Ethan convince the man he abandoned that their love is worth risking it all?
As old feelings reignite and secrets unravel, Jimmy and Ethan must decide if they’re ready to face the past—or if the wounds of betrayal are too deep to heal.

Greyson Vale's Unlocking Melodies is a poignant exploration of love, memory, and redemption that captivates readers from the very first page. The novel intricately weaves a tale of two estranged lovers, Jimmy and Ethan, whose paths cross again under circumstances fraught with danger and emotional turmoil. Vale's narrative is a masterclass in character development and thematic depth, making it a compelling read for anyone interested in stories of second chances and the complexities of human relationships.
At the heart of Unlocking Melodies is the character of Jimmy, a man grappling with the fragments of a life he can barely remember. His journey is one of self-discovery and resilience, as he attempts to piece together his past while navigating the present dangers posed by his father's dubious dealings. Jimmy's character is beautifully crafted, with Vale capturing the nuances of his vulnerability and strength. The reader is drawn into Jimmy's world, feeling his confusion, fear, and determination as he strives to reclaim his identity.
In stark contrast, Ethan Cole is portrayed as a man burdened by guilt and regret. Now a tech billionaire, Ethan's past decisions haunt him, particularly the choice to leave Jimmy for what he believed was Jimmy's own good. Vale skillfully delves into Ethan's psyche, revealing a man who is both powerful and deeply flawed. His journey is one of redemption, as he seeks to make amends for the pain he caused. The complexity of Ethan's character adds depth to the narrative, making his struggle to win back Jimmy's trust both compelling and heart-wrenching.
The chemistry between Jimmy and Ethan is palpable, with Vale expertly capturing the tension and unresolved emotions that linger between them. Their reunion is anything but simple, as old wounds are reopened and new challenges arise. The dynamic between the two characters is a testament to Vale's ability to write authentic and emotionally charged relationships. The dialogue is sharp and poignant, reflecting the deep connection and history shared by Jimmy and Ethan.
One of the standout themes in Unlocking Melodies is the exploration of trust and betrayal. Vale delves into the impact of past betrayals on present relationships, highlighting the difficulty of rebuilding trust once it has been broken. This theme is particularly resonant in the context of Jimmy and Ethan's relationship, as they grapple with the scars of their past while trying to forge a new future together. The novel raises important questions about forgiveness and the possibility of healing, making it a thought-provoking read.
Another significant theme is the idea of memory and identity. Jimmy's struggle with his patchy memory serves as a metaphor for the broader quest for self-discovery and understanding. Vale uses this theme to explore the ways in which our past shapes our present and the importance of confronting our history in order to move forward. The novel's exploration of memory is both poignant and insightful, adding an additional layer of depth to the narrative.
In terms of style, Vale's writing is both lyrical and evocative. The prose is rich and descriptive, painting vivid pictures of the settings and emotions that drive the story. The pacing is well-balanced, with moments of tension and introspection seamlessly woven together. Vale's ability to create a sense of atmosphere and mood is one of the novel's greatest strengths, immersing the reader in the world of Oakwood Grove and the lives of its characters.
Comparatively, Unlocking Melodies shares thematic similarities with works by authors such as Taylor Jenkins Reid and Colleen Hoover, who also explore complex relationships and the intricacies of love and forgiveness. However, Vale's unique voice and focus on the interplay between memory and identity set this novel apart, offering a fresh perspective on familiar themes.
Overall, Unlocking Melodies is a beautifully crafted novel that resonates on multiple levels. Greyson Vale has created a story that is both emotionally engaging and intellectually stimulating, with characters that linger in the reader's mind long after the final page is turned. For those seeking a story of love, redemption, and the power of memory, this book is a must-read.
